Properties of Silty Soil:
* Particle Size: Silt particles range in size from 0.002 to 0.05 mm.
* Texture: Silty soil feels smooth and floury to the touch. It's soft and easily molded when wet.
* Drainage: Silty soil drains well, but not as quickly as sandy soil.
* Water Retention: Silty soil holds water better than sandy soil but not as well as clay soil.
* Nutrient Retention: Silty soil is good at holding nutrients, making it fertile for plant growth.
* Compaction: Silty soil can become compacted over time, especially if it's heavily trafficked.
* Aeration: Silty soil generally has good aeration, allowing roots to grow easily.
Uses of Silty Soil:
* Agriculture: Silty soil is excellent for growing a wide variety of crops due to its good drainage, water retention, and nutrient content.
* Landscaping: It's also used in landscaping for its attractive appearance and ability to support plant life.
* Construction: Silty soil is used in construction as a filler material and for building foundations.
Challenges of Silty Soil:
* Compaction: Silty soil can compact easily, hindering root growth and reducing aeration.
* Erosion: Silty soil is susceptible to erosion, especially if it's left bare.
Tips for Managing Silty Soil:
* Avoid compaction: Minimize foot traffic and heavy machinery use on silty soil.
* Improve drainage: Add organic matter to improve drainage and aeration.
* Prevent erosion: Use cover crops or mulch to protect the soil from erosion.
